TROUBLESHOOTING
Check to see if there is any object between the product and the remote control
causing obstruction.
Ensure you are pointing
the remote control directly
at the TV.
IMM Ensure that the batteries are installed with correct
polarity
(+ to +, - to -).
,MM Ensure that the correct
remote operating
mode is set: TV, VCR etc.
IMM Install new batteries.
i,i,ff Is the sleep timer set?
i,l,_ Check the power control settings. Power interrupted.

I,I,I Check whether the product
is turned on.
i,i,i Try another
channel. The problem may be with the broadcast.
Is the power cord inserted
into wall power outlet?
Check your antenna direction
and/or
location.
uuf_
Test the wall power outlet, plug another
product's
power cord into the outlet
where the product's
power cord was plugged
in.
i,i,ff This is normal, the image is muted during the product
startup
process. Please
contact your service center, if the picture has not appeared after five minutes.
i,i,i Adjust Color in menu option.
i,i,i Keep a sufficient
distance between the product
and the VCR.
i,i,i Try another
channel. The problem may be with the broadcast.
i,i,i Are the video cables installed properly?
i,i,ff Activate
any function
to restore the brightness
of the picture.
I,I,ff Check for local interference
such as an electrical
appliance
or power tool.
i,i,i Station or cable product
experiencing
problems, tune to another
station.
i,i,i Station signal is weak, reorient
antenna to receive weaker station.
i,l,ll Check for sources of possible interference.
i,i,i Check antenna (Change the direction
of the antenna).
i,i,i Check HDMI cable over version 1.3.
The HDMI cables don't
support
HDMI version 1.3, it cause flickers or no screen
display. In this case use the latest cables that support
HDMI version 1.3.
